### **How to Watch Super Bowl LIX for Free Without Cable**

This year’s Super Bowl will be broadcast on Fox, featuring commentary from none other than Tom Brady—yes, that Tom Brady, who is no stranger to Super Bowls. Previously, Fox has provided complimentary streaming of the game via the Fox Sports app, but there’s a twist this year. The game will be streamed free on [Tubi](https://tubitv.com/how-to-watch-the-super-bowl), a no-cost streaming platform.

Tubi’s coverage will encompass everything you’d experience on traditional TV: pregame and postgame analysis, all the commercials, and, naturally, Kendrick Lamar’s halftime performance. To watch the game, you’ll need to set up a Tubi account, but don’t worry—it’s totally free. For those without cable, Tubi will be the easiest and most hassle-free method to enjoy the big event.

### **Alternative Ways to Watch the Game**

While Tubi is the most straightforward choice, there are other options to catch Super Bowl LIX if Tubi isn’t accessible. Several cable-alternative streaming services also feature Fox, allowing you to tune in through any of the following platforms:

– **YouTube TV**
– **Hulu with Live TV**
– **Sling TV**
– **DirecTV Stream**
– **Fubo**

All these services provide access to your local Fox affiliate, so you can watch the game live. Keep in mind that most of these platforms require a subscription, though some may have free trials for new users.

If streaming services don’t suit you, there’s another route: a [digital TV antenna](https://www.pcmag.com/picks/how-to-find-the-best-digital-tv-antenna). For as little as $20, you can buy an antenna that connects directly to your TV and picks up local channels, including Fox. This is a one-time purchase that could also grant you access to future Super Bowls and various live events.
